FAU on-campus stadium APPROVED

> Posted by Ted Hutton at 2:25 PM

This just in: By unanimous vote, the BOT has approved plans for a $62 million, 30,000-seat on-campus stadium to open September 2010.

The vote was no surprise, but it took forever to get there. Nearly five hours of presentations, speeches, most b-o-r-i-n-g but I guess necessary. There were a couple nice hilites.

Couple heros for stadium backers: BOT chair Norm Tripp, who really did get choked up when he gave his speech, which was comparable to anything I have heard from The Voice.

"When [the state] gave us a university, they didn?t tell us we had to be a second rate university forever. We have the right to make this a world class institution right now. We have a right to bring to this university a full experience. We have the right to become a world class university."

Great stuff, and there was more.

And Craig Dunlap (see below).

WORD OF CAUTION: There is still work to do. The stadium is supposed to be self sufficient, so the money needs to come from sale of naming rights, suites, club seats, other sponsorships, donations, etc.

FAU has about a year to get the money lined up. Is there a chance they won't get it? Slim one, but I really, really doubt anything can stop this now.

FAU trustees approve stadium plan
South Florida Business Journal - 4:17 PM EDT Tuesday, September 18, 2007by Brian Bandell

Print this Article Email this Article Reprints RSS Feeds Most Viewed Most Emailed

Florida Atlantic University's board of trustees unanimously approved a plan to build a 30,000-seat football stadium on its Boca Raton campus in a $62 million project.

The Tuesday vote authorized FAU President Frank Brogan and his staff to secure bond financing, a letter of credit from a financial institution and assemble a design and construction team. In order to obtain financial backing, FAU will begin selling box suites, club seats, sponsorships and naming rights. The state university's foundation will begin a fundraising drive.

Brogan said 15 people wanted suites before the stadium was even approved. He is optimistic that the university will meet all of its revenue goals for the project.

"When the Legislature gave us this university in Broward and Palm Beach counties, they didn't say we had to be a second-rate university forever," FAU board of trustees Chairman Norman Tripp said. "We have the right to make this a world-class institution now. We can bring to this university the full experience."

The steel stadium will be on the northeast corner of the campus. One end zone would be left open to allow for expansion. Construction would start in spring 2009 and finish in time for the fall 2010 season.

Plans call for 25 box suites - with 20 of them available for lease at about $45,000 each - and 1,000 club seats selling for $1,000 each. An analysis by Chicago-based C.H. Johnson Consulting estimated first year revenue of $6.7 million and operating expenses of $1.4 million. The operating income after debt service would be $4.8 million.

That's based on attendance averaging 16,200 a game, plus several high school football games and one special event. Last season, the Owls' average attendance of 9,726 ranked last in the Sun Belt Conference.

Charles Johnson, principal of the consulting company, pointed to big attendance boosts at the University of Central Florida and the University of Connecticut after completing their on-campus stadiums as precedent for FAU's success by doing the same. He said the estimate for FAU was conservative and attendance was bound to improve over time.

Johnson noted that UCF sold out its suites and club seats and wished it planned for more.

"This is a stronger market than Orlando, even through it is more competitive here," he said after describing the large population and wealthy demographics.
